Perfect Square
15904575729358323603504829322209627039540554930342212329 is a perfect square (3988054128188122223434054573 × 3988054128188122223434054573)
15904575729358323603504829322209627039540554930342212329 is a perfect square (3988054128188122223434054573 × 3988054128188122223434054573)
10100110 00001101 00110000 01010001 00101001 00110011 11010011 00101000 01110000 01010111 00111001 00011010 00000110 01001010 01101111 11000111 01100010 01101100 11100100 10011111 10111110 00110010 11101001
15904575729358323603504829322209627039540554930342212329 is odd
Previous odd number is 15904575729358323603504829322209627039540554930342212327
Next odd number is 15904575729358323603504829322209627039540554930342212331
4023150369222206746849822038181115134958486774301036361306694870604379236433864387110560832320279040755722351595256331738864227027786018993733309342177192897870887289
252955529130893851215989851349434195858960922121375493395007391341119972710279399963192401685212573218119604241
12301514050451147514503405347106403112337435423316223757431351